SMG File Extension

SolidWorks Composer File
- File Type smg
- Developer Dassault Systemes
- Popularity
- Application 3DVIA Virtools
- Category 3D Image Files
What is a SMG file?
The SMG file extension is linked to SolidWorks Composer File and belongs to the 3D Image Files category, which includes 618 files.
The SolidWorks Composer File (SMG) was created by Dassault, a company that developed file format and produced 6 programs for their use.
SMG file support extends to various operating systems, including Windows. If you need to open a SMG file, you can use one of 2 programs, such as 3DVIA Virtools and 3DVIA Player.
Programs that support SMG files

Windows

Online Services
How to open a SMG file?
If you’re having difficulty opening a SMG file, it is often due to not having the correct software. To solve the problem, choose a compatible program from the list. Then follow the link to the official developer site, download the software, and install it on your device.
When it comes to opening and working with SMG files, 3DVIA Virtools and 3DVIA Player are the top choices for users. If you need the newest version of 3DVIA Virtools, just access the Dassault website. From there you can download the installer compatible with all systems.
When you finish installing 3DVIA Virtools, the system will automatically launch SMG files with it.
Set 3DVIA Virtools as the default SMG application
Changing Default Programs in Windows
- Right-click your SMG file, then navigate to the "Open With" option and click "Choose Another Application" to continue;
- From the options listed in the pop-up window, specifically choose 3DVIA Virtools as the application to handle your SMG file;
- Be sure to check the "Always use this app" checkbox and click "OK" to save your preference.
Change the default app that opens a file on Mac
- Right-click or use Control + Left-click on the desired SMG file to open a menu where you can choose from multiple actions;
- Select "Open in application" and click "Other";
- At the bottom of the window, you will see the "Enable" menu. It is already set to the default option, "Recommended Programs";
- Within this menu, select "All Programs" and then search for 3DVIA Virtools. Check the box next to "Always open in app" to make it the default program.
How to edit a SMG file?
To edit SMG files, it is essential to install software that supports not only viewing but also editing the 3d image files. Online SMG editors provide limited functionality compared to full-featured software for SolidWorks Composer File.
Best SMG editors in 2026
After analyzing the criteria, we have created a list of SMG editors available for use.
| SMG Editor Software | Developer | Platforms | Overall Rating |
|---|---|---|---|
| 3DVIA Virtools | Dassault | Windows | 4.3 out of 5 (40 reviews) |
Troubleshooting guide for SMG file complications
When facing challenges with SMG files, simple adjustments in your software can often solve the problem. Find helpful troubleshooting guidance below.
What can lead to sudden 3DVIA Virtools crashes?
3DVIA Virtools crashes can occur due to outdated software versions. To mitigate this, install the latest updates for Dassault products.
Restarting your computer is a crucial troubleshooting measure that can alleviate numerous common problems. Therefore, it is advisable to restart your computer before modifying any settings related to the software.
What is the recommended approach to repair a damaged SMG file?
Open the damaged SMG file with a recovery program, and then select the "Repair" menu item to start the repair process. Then wait for the recovery process to complete, which allows you to automatically repair corrupted 3d image files.
What are the telltale signs of a corrupt SMG file?
Common indications of damaged SMG 3d image files are:
- Unexplained increase in SMG file size;
- File hangs or crashes in 3DVIA Virtools or other programs;
- The file does not open or opens with errors;
- While working with the file, error messages appear;
- Editing the archive in 3DVIA Virtools results in slow or unresponsive behavior;

